What Types of Work and Facilities Can School Occupational Therapists Expect in Essex Junction, VT?

As a School Occupational Therapist in Essex Junction, Vermont, you can expect to work in a dynamic educational environment including public and private schools, specialized therapeutic settings, and collaborative multidisciplinary teams focused on student well-being and success. Your role will involve assessing students’ physical, sensory, and cognitive needs, designing and implementing individualized intervention plans, and working closely with teachers and parents to promote functional skills crucial for academic achievement and social integration. Additionally, you may engage in activities that support fine motor development, sensory processing, and adaptive strategies, while providing consultation and training to school staff to create inclusive classrooms that accommodate diverse learning styles. Overall, the opportunity to impact students’ developmental trajectories in Essex Junction is both rewarding and essential to fostering a supportive educational atmosphere.

AMN Healthcare is partnering with a Royalton Vermont school district to hire a qualified Occupational Therapist (OT) to work with one of the top districts in the area, providing services to children of all ages. Generally, the OT will address motor skills, sensory processing, and cognitive functions that impact a student’s academics, self-care skills, play, and social participation, as well as transitional skills. Responsibilities for this role include: Partner with the district as a member of a collaborative team to help students achieve their academic goals. Screen and evaluate students referred to Occupational Therapy. Appropriately collect data and report findings. Provide evidence-based direct and consultative therapy services as required. Maintain accurate documentation and billing per district and state standards. The OT will provide training and resources for teachers and staff on effective strategies to improve participation and progress toward educational goals. Participate in a collaborative team and maintain clear communication with teachers, district staff, and families regarding student performance.
